摘要

The wetting of lead-silicate glasses S87-2 and S78-4 by a 0.2 N HCl solution and spreading of the solution over the glass surfaces before and after their thermo-hydrogen reduction was studied. It was shown that thermo-hydrogen reduction improves the interaction of glass with acid solutions. The results are explained by the appearance of lead on the surface of the studied glasses and the dewatering of the glass during thermo-hydrogen reduction of lead-silicate glasses.
